LOTUS LIVE: Zar Electrik

Zar Electrik brought their boundary-pushing sound to WFHB for a special Lotus Live Session on September 26, 2025. With members hailing from France and Morocco, the trio fuses North African and Sub-Saharan traditions with electronic textures, creating an intercontinental groove that blurs the lines between trance, funk, and global folk.<br /> <br /> Hosted by Adriane Pontecorvo, the conversation explored Zar Electrik’s unique blend of influences, their collaborative approach to songwriting, and the energy they bring to the stage. LOTUS LIVE: Puuluup

Estonian duo Puuluup joined WFHB for a special Lotus Live Session on September 26, 2025. With their playful, genre-defying approach, Puuluup reimagines the ancient Talharpa (a traditional bowed lyre) by blending it with modern loops, electronics, and quirky humor. The result is music that’s earthy, experimental, and full of charm — equal parts tradition and innovation.<br /> <br /> Hosted by Adriane Pontecorvo, the session explored Puuluup’s creative process, their love of reviving folk instruments for contemporary audiences, and the ways their performances invite listeners into a joyful, offbeat sound world.
